The Eagles added North Carolina WR Mack Hollins in the 4th round of the 2017 NFL Draft. He totaled 65 catches, 1,358 yards and 16 scores across 2014 and 2015 before missing time this past year with a collarbone injury that required surgery. Hollins is a big 6'4, 221-pounder and is considered 1 of the better blockers and special teamers in this year's WR class. There's some long-term upside here, but Hollins figures to be buried in Philadelphia's deep WR group this season.
